From 4 to 9 January 2023, the sisters of the Territory of Peru, Brazil, Mexico and Bolivia held their annual retreat at the Good Mother Meeting House in Lima. The theme was: "Embracing our vulnerability in Jesus for the Kingdom".

Our sister Goyi Marín ss.cc., of the general government, invited us to reflect and meditate on the following themes: Naming and embracing my vulnerability; Jesus, a vulnerable man who assumes his vulnerability; naming and embracing community vulnerability; the vulnerability of the community of Jesus; liberating encounters of Jesus; the vulnerability of creation; entering into the synodal process, as consecrated women, embracing our vulnerability; celebrating vulnerability embraced and assumed.

All the sisters of the Territory are grateful for these days which have truly been a space of encounter with this God who loves us, who calls us and who counts on us, from our vulnerability, to announce his merciful love. We also thank Goyi for her kindness in sharing the retreat with our older sisters of the Bethlehem community, at a different time and in her own community. She leaves us with the challenge to continue to recognise and embrace our vulnerabilities from below, from the bowels, from the centre and from within.
